Eine Abfrage ist eine Anforderung von Informationen aus einer Datenbank. Sie wird in einer speziellen Sprache, der Structured Query Language (SQL), geschrieben. Der Zweck einer Abfrage besteht darin, bestimmte Daten aus einer Datenbank abzurufen.
Abfragen werden in einer Vielzahl von Kontexten verwendet, von alltäglichen Aufgaben wie dem Abrufen von Kontaktinformationen eines Kunden bis hin zu komplexen Aufgaben wie der Erstellung von Berichten oder der Analyse großer Datenmengen. Abfragen können auch zum Hinzufügen, Ändern oder Löschen von Daten in einer Datenbank verwendet werden.
Abfragen lassen sich in zwei Typen unterteilen: Auswahlabfragen und Aktionsabfragen. Mit Select-Abfragen werden Daten aus der Datenbank abgerufen, während mit Action-Abfragen Daten hinzugefügt, geändert oder gelöscht werden.
Um eine Abfrage zu schreiben, muss man zunächst die Struktur der Datenbank kennen. Dazu gehören die Tabellen, Felder und Beziehungen zwischen den Tabellen. Sobald die Struktur verstanden ist, kann eine Abfrage in SQL geschrieben werden.
Die Abfrageoptimierung ist der Prozess der Verbesserung der Leistung einer Abfrage. Dies kann durch die Verwendung von Indizes, die Verwendung der richtigen Datentypen und die Verwendung der richtigen Operatoren erreicht werden.
Die Leistung einer Abfrage wird durch die Anzahl der zurückgegebenen Datensätze, die Zeit, die zum Abrufen der Daten benötigt wird, und die Menge der verwendeten Systemressourcen bestimmt.
Wenn eine Abfrage nicht die erwarteten Ergebnisse liefert, ist es wichtig, das Problem zu beheben. Dazu gehört die Überprüfung der Syntax der Abfrage, die Analyse des Abfrageplans und die Untersuchung des Ausführungsplans.
Es gibt eine Reihe von Tools, die beim Schreiben von Abfragen und bei der Fehlersuche helfen. Dazu gehören der Query Analyzer, der Query Builder und der SQL Profiler.
In der Datenbanksprache ist eine Abfrage eine Anfrage nach Daten oder Informationen aus einer Datenbank. Eine Abfrage kann eine einfache Abfrage von Daten aus einer einzigen Tabelle sein oder eine komplexere Abfrage, die Daten aus mehreren Tabellen oder sogar aus anderen Datenbanken abruft.
Eine Abfrage ist ein Satz von Anweisungen, die dazu dienen, Daten aus einer Datenbank zu extrahieren. Eine Abfrage kann zum Beispiel verwendet werden, um alle Daten aus einer Tabelle in einer Datenbank zu extrahieren.
Eine Abfrage in Agile ist eine Frage oder eine Anfrage nach Informationen, die zur Steuerung des Entwicklungsprozesses verwendet wird. Abfragen können verwendet werden, um Informationen über Benutzerbedürfnisse, Produktanforderungen oder den Projektfortschritt zu sammeln. Sie können auch dazu dienen, Konflikte zu lösen oder Projektabhängigkeiten zu verfolgen.
Es gibt vier Arten von Abfragen: Auswählen, Einfügen, Aktualisieren und Löschen.
Select-Abfragen rufen Daten aus einer Datenbank ab. Einfügeabfragen fügen neue Datensätze zu einer Datenbank hinzu. Aktualisierungsabfragen ändern bestehende Datensätze in einer Datenbank. Löschabfragen löschen Datensätze aus einer Datenbank.
1. SELECT-Anweisung ohne WHERE-Klausel
2. SELECT-Anweisung mit einer WHERE-Klausel
3. SELECT-Anweisung mit einer GROUP BY-Klausel